I recently had the wonderful opportunity to create a pencil portrait of a family.
During the process, the client approached me with a specific request. They asked me to 'remove' the lollipop from the little girl's hand and instead draw her with a genuine smile. I accepted the challenge and set out to create a portrait. The changes I made had successfully transformed the portrait into a true reflection of their familial connection.
I'm thrilled to share that the family was delighted with the final results. I am grateful for the opportunity to have played a small part in capturing their happiness and creating a lasting memory through my artwork...
Materials: ~Size: A4 - 21x29,7cm. ~Paper : 250gms; ~Pencils, : Mechanical pencils, Graphite - Koh-i-Noor, Creatacolor. ~Other materials for blending - q-tips, eyeshadow applicator, tissue. ~Sakura gel pen (white).
